All Drury Hotels in or near Castle Rock

Drury Inn & Suites Denver Near The Tech Center in Englewood
+1-888-389-4121
9445 East Dry Creek Rd., Englewood, CO 80112 +1-888-389-4121 ~14.51 miles north of Castle Rock center
  • 4-star Suburban hotel
  • Hotel has a green policy Learn more
More details
From$85
Very Good 4.5 /5 Review Score Call BookMore Details
Drury Inn & Suites Colorado Springs Near Air Force : 1170 Interquest Pkwy.
+1-888-675-2083
1170 Interquest Pkwy., Colorado Springs, CO 80921 +1-888-675-2083 ~26.36 miles south of Castle Rock center
  • Mid-scale Suburban hotel
  • 18 suites in property
More details
From$104
Average 3.0 /5 Guest Reviews Call BookMore Details
Drury Inn & Suites Denver Central Park - Denver
+1-800-716-8490
4550 North Central Park Blvd., Denver, CO 80238 +1-800-716-8490 ~28.23 miles north of Castle Rock center
  • Three Star Highway hotel
  • Fitness + Health Center
More details
From$104
Average 3.0 /5 Read Reviews Call BookMore Details
Drury Plaza Hotel Denver Westminster : 10393 Reed St.
+1-800-805-5223
10393 Reed St., Westminster, CO 80021 +1-800-805-5223 ~37.40 miles north of Castle Rock center
  • Midscale Highway hotel
  • 23 suites in hotel
More details
From$113
Excellent 5.0 /5 Recent Reviews Call BookMore Details

Hotels like Drury Hotels

The Inverness Denver a Hilton Golf & Spa Resort : 200 Inverness Dr. West
+1-888-389-4121
200 Inverness Dr. West, Englewood, CO 80112 +1-888-389-4121
  • Expensive Golf Course hotel
  • 302 rooms in hotel
From$125
Average 3.0 /5 Recent Reviews Call BookMore Details
Doubletree by Hilton Denver Tech Center
+1-888-675-2083
7801 East Orchard Rd., Greenwood Village, CO 80111 +1-888-675-2083
  • 4-star Suburban property
  • 19 conference rooms in property
From$125
Average 3.0 /5 Reviews Call BookMore Details
Denver Marriott Tech Center
+1-800-716-8490
4900 South Syracuse St., Denver, CO 80237 +1-800-716-8490
  • High end Suburban property
  • Hotel has 605 rooms
From$149
Very Good 4.5 /5 Read Reviews Call BookMore Details
Hyatt Regency Denver Tech Center
+1-800-805-5223
7800 East Tufts Ave., Denver, CO 80237 +1-800-805-5223
  • 4-star Suburban property
  • Hotel has 451 rooms
From$90
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Back to Top